Cordova Recreation and Park District Celebrates 60 Years of Service

RANCHO CORDOVA, CA (MPG) - Cordova Recreation and Park District residents of all ages celebrated the District’s 60th Anniversary at the Neil Orchard Senior Center and Lincoln Village Community Park on July 20, 2018. District Administrator, Patrick Larkin, said the occasion exemplified what the organization stands for:

“The 60th Anniversary community celebration was a great opportunity for our residents to see firsthand the benefits and value of recreation and parks. The smiles and fun the attendees were having; dancing, swimming, playing and just enjoying the band and park environment is what CRPD is all about. We create community and facilitate its positive growth. We strive to maintain and sustain a high quality of life for our residents through our parks and recreation services.”

The District’s Party in the Park highlighting the 60th Anniversary celebration was well attended. Hundreds of residents joined the District in playful reflection of its past, present, and future goals in the Cordova community; with July being National Parks and Recreation month it is the perfect time to celebrate the role of parks and recreation.

In recognition of this role, Larkin said, “We look forward to continuing to provide excellent service to the Cordova Recreation and Park District community to the best of our abilities and are honored that so many people joined us to help celebrate the past 60 years. Our future is very bright. We thank you for your support, partnerships and friendships.”

In attendance and presenting the Cordova Recreation and Park District Board with Resolutions were Congressman Ami Bera, Mayor Linda Budge, Assemblyman Ken Cooley, Senator Jim Nielson, Congresswoman Doris Matsui, Sacramento County Supervisor Don Nottoli and Rancho Cordova Chamber of Commerce President Diann Rogers. 

The Party in the Park and 60th Anniversary event was made possible by local sponsorships from KP International, California American Water and ‘Ol Republic Brewery. The incredible music was provided by the local City of Trees Brass Band.
